Are gray wolves in a forest an example of population?

Yes, the gray wolves in a forest are an example of a population.

Here's why:

* Population refers to a group of individuals of the same species living in the same area at the same time.

* The gray wolves in the forest are all the same species and are sharing that particular forest habitat.
